Preparing for Operation

Use the following procedure to prepare the aerial platform

for operation.

1. Perform a prestart inspection as described in Chap-

ter 7.

2. Place the battery disconnect switch in the on posi-

tion.

3. Close and latch the doors.

4. Before painting or sandblasting make sure the sand-

blast protection kit and the platform control cover are

properly installed. These options, when used prop-

erly will protect the control placards and cylinder rods

from paint overspray and abrasion while sandblast-

ing.

Lower Controls

The lower controls override the upper controls. This means

that the lower controls can always be used to operate

the platform regardless of the position of the upper con-

trol emergency stop button.

Boom, turntable, and platform functions may be oper-

ated from the lower controls. The lower controls may be

used for initial set up of the aerial platform, and for testing

and inspection.

Use the following procedure to operate boom, turntable,

or platform functions using the lower controls. Refer to

Figure 8.2.

1. Pull the emergency stop button (refer to Figure 8.2)

outward. Insert the key in the control selector and

turn the switch to the lower control position.

2. Press the start button until the engine starts, then

release. The engine will not start if the control selec-

tor switch is left in the lower control position for 30

seconds or longer before starting the engine. The

control selector switch must be turned back to off

before the engine will start.

3. Let the engine warm to operating temperature.

4. Hold the ground operation switch up while operating

the control toggle switches.

5. Hold the appropriate toggle switch in the desired di-

rection.

6. Release the function toggle switch to stop movement.

7. Place the ground operation switch in the off position

when no functions are being operated.

Upper Controls

The upper controls may be used for driving the aerial plat-

form and positioning the booms and platform while on the

job.

Use the following procedure to operate machine func-

tions using the upper controls.

1. At the lower controls, pull the emergency stop but-

ton outward. Insert the key in the control selector

and turn the switch to the upper control position.

2. Enter the platform and securely close the gate.

3. Attach the fall restraint lanyard to one of the anchor

points.

4. Pull the emergency stop outward (refer to Figure 8.3).

5. Turn the anti-restart master switch to on and pause

a few seconds while the alarm sounds to alert others

that the machine is about to start. Turn the switch to

start, then release it to on. The engine will not start if

the switch is left in the on position for 30 seconds or

longer before turning it to start. The switch must be

turned back to off before the engine will start.

6. Let the engine warm to operating temperature.
